Welcome to on-call for the Bramblekit component library. Versions follow semver; consumers pin minor versions, and nightly canaries exercise the latest patch. If a canary fails, freeze publishing via the Larkspur dashboard before paging the owning team. Publishing requires the registry credential, which the CI env file defines on the next line.

secret setting of yagef-baweg: RELAY_SECRET29=cb53deb59a49ed54d9f43599b54ca

Runbook: PeriodWeave timetable solver (Nordqvist Academy deploy). If the solver hangs past 20 min, kill the worker, clear the constraint cache under /var/periodweave/cache, and restart with --cold. Do not edit teacher-availability rows mid-run; the solver snapshots them at start. Config lives in /etc/periodweave/solver.env. Rotate credentials quarterly via the Hylte vault tool, then redeploy. The solver authenticates to the constraint store with a token. Add that token on the next line.

env line for fafof-fahag: LEDGER_TOKEN5=f8790

### Runbook: Catalogue Import — Fernholt Library Platform

For this week's sync: the quarterly catalogue import into Shelfwright runs Tuesday night. Before kicking it off, confirm the staging mirror matches production counts, then lock the ingest queue so partial records can't interleave. The import bundle must be signed before the orchestrator will accept it — unsigned bundles are rejected silently, which bit us last quarter, so double-check. Once signed, trigger the dry run and compare row deltas. Sign the bundle with the following key.

rollout seal: bky4_DFM9

Subject: FeedProof cut-over done

Welcome aboard. Quick recap: the podcast feed validator (FeedProof) moved to the new Larkspur region over the weekend. Validation queues drained cleanly, and the legacy workers are now read-only until Friday. You'll mostly touch the scheduler and the RSS linting rules. To get your local environment matching production, use the settings that follow.

service settings:
[casax]
port = 6379
team = rusir
host = casax.zemvarhq.corp
region = outer-4
access_code = ac_9808ce
timeout_ms = 1500